Understanding Twitter’s Significance Twitter, which was founded in 2006, has grown into a powerful microblogging platform. Twitter has a global reach, with over 330 million monthly active users (as of September 2021), making it an excellent channel for businesses to connect with their audience on a more personal level. Twitter’s real-time nature is one of its distinguishing features, allowing users to participate in conversations and stay up to date on current events, trends, and breaking news. Twitter offers unique opportunities for social media marketing due to its active user base, diverse audience, and ability to drive social media engagement. Hashtags play an important role on Twitter, allowing users to discover viral content and participate in relevant discussions. Using trending hashtags can propel your brand to the forefront, attracting more attention and followers. Identifying Your Target Audience’s Twitter Presence Understanding your target audience and where they are most active is critical to the success of any marketing strategy. Conduct extensive market research to determine whether your target audience uses Twitter. Analyze demographics, interests, and online behavior to accurately predict their social media habits. Twitter attracts a younger demographic, with a sizable proportion of users aged 18 to 34. Furthermore, professionals and thought leaders from a variety of industries are active on Twitter. If your company caters to these demographics or wants to establish a strong presence among millennials and professionals, Twitter could be a great place to engage with them. However, if your target audience is primarily older people who are less tech-savvy, or if your products or services do not lend themselves to quick, concise messaging, other social media platforms such as Facebook or LinkedIn may be more appropriate. Assessing the Suitability of Your Content for Twitter Twitter’s character limit, which was initially set at 140 characters and was later increased to 280, necessitates concise and impactful messaging. Because of this constraint, businesses must be creative in their communication, conveying their brand message in succinct yet engaging tweets. The platform thrives on real-time updates, quick interactions, and the ability to initiate discussions. Platforms like Instagram and Facebook may better suit your brand if you have content based on visual storytelling or long narratives. Instagram, for example, is primarily focused on images and short videos, making it ideal for displaying products or behind-the-scenes content. Facebook, on the other hand, allows for longer posts and has more features, such as groups and events. Twitter, on the other hand, can be a valuable marketing channel if your company can effectively deliver its message in short bursts or if you want to stay connected with your audience in real-time. To maximize social media engagement, you must adapt your content to Twitter’s format and use images, videos, or links to supplement your tweets. Understanding the Power of Social Media Advertising Social media platforms’ meteoric rise has transformed the marketing landscape. Businesses now have access to a large pool of potential customers, allowing them to reach out to precise audiences. There are numerous benefits to using social media advertising, including: 1.1 Unrivaled Reach and social media engagement: With billions of active users on plat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ter, businesses have unrivaled reach and engagement potential. Businesses can interact directly with their target audience, fostering relationships and brand loyalty. 1.2 Advanced Targeting Options: Social media platforms provide sophisticated targeting tools that enable businesses to narrow their audience based on demographics, interests, behaviors, and other factors. This precise targeting ensures that advertisements reach the right people, increasing conversion rates. 1.3 Cost-Effectiveness: When compared to traditional advertising, social media advertising can be surprisingly affordable. Businesses can optimize spending and get the most out of their advertising budgets by using options such as pay-per-click (PPC) and budget controls. 1.4 Measurable Results: Social media analytics provide useful information about ad performance, audience behavior, and campaign effectiveness. This data-driven approach enables businesses to improve their strategies and results over time. 2. Countering the Drawbacks of Social Media Advertising While social media advertising has advantages, there are some disadvantages that business owners should be aware of: 2.1 Ad Fatigue: Constant exposure to advertisements can cause ad fatigue in social media users, resulting in lower social media engagement and ad effectiveness. To keep audience interest, businesses must strike a balance between promotion and engaging content. 2.2 Privacy Concerns: In recent years, social media platforms have come under fire for data privacy violations. To avoid backlash and protect their reputation, businesses must handle user data responsibly and transparently. 2.3 Intense Competition: As social media advertising has grown in popularity, so has competition for ad space. Businesses may have to bid higher to get their ads in front of the right people, which will affect overall ad costs. 2.4 Negative Feedback: Social media platforms allow users to freely express their opinions, which can lead to negative feedback for businesses. It is critical to effectively handle criticism in order to maintain a positive brand image. 3. Budget Allocation: Setting Realistic Expectations One of the first steps in social media advertising is determining your campaign’s budget. While it may be tempting to enter the fray with a large budget, it is critical to set realistic expectations and consider factors such as: 3.1 Business Objectives: Match your social media advertising budget to your overall business goals. Do you want to raise brand awareness, drive website traffic, or increase sales? Different goals may necessitate different budget levels. 3.2 Platform Selection: The advertising costs and reach of different social media platforms vary. For example, Facebook and Instagram ads may have different cost-per-click (CPC) or impression rates. Choose platforms that are appropriate for your target audience and budget. 3.3 Testing and Scaling: Allocate a portion of your budget to test various ad formats, creatives, and targeting options. When you’ve identified successful campaigns, you can increase your budget to scale them up. 4. Targeting Options: Reaching the Right Audience The ability to precisely target your audience is one of the most significant benefits of social media advertising. Understanding the targeting options available will allow you to reach the right people at the right time: 4.1 Demographics: Use age, gender, location, language, education, and other demographic factors to target your ads. Ad relevance and social media engagement can be increased by tailoring your messaging to specific demographics. 4.2 Interests and Behaviors: Social media platforms collect data on users’ interests, hobbies, and behaviors, allowing businesses to target people who have specific affinities with their products or services. 4.3 Custom Audiences: Create custom audiences by leveraging existing customer data, such as email lists or website visitors. These audiences are more likely to convert because they are already familiar with your brand. 4.4 Lookalike Audiences: Platforms such as Facebook allow businesses to create lookalike audiences that are similar to their existing customer base. This allows you to reach a larger but still relevant audience. 5. Ad Content Creation: Captivating Your Audience A successful social media advertising campaign is built on effective ad content. Use the following content creation tips to captivate your audience: 5.1 Visual Appeal: Use high-quality images and videos that draw attention and clearly communicate your brand message. Visual content performs better and generates more engagement. 5.2 Ad Copy: Create concise and compelling ad copy that highlights your product or service’s value proposition. To persuade users to take the desired action, use persuasive language and calls-to-action (CTAs). 5.3 A/B Testing: Experiment with different ad variations to determine which elements are most appealing to your target audience. A/B testing allows you to maximize the impact of your ad content. 5.4 Ad Formats: To keep your audience engaged and prevent ad fatigue, use a variety of ad formats, such as carousel ads, video ads, and sponsored posts. 6. Analyzing Competition A competitive analysis is an important step in understanding how your competitors use social media and what you can learn from their strategies. Begin by identifying your primary market competitors. Look for businesses that have a similar target audience and offer comparable products or services to yours. Investigate their social media presence and activities across multiple platforms. Examine the type of content they post, the frequency with which they post, and how they interact with their followers. Take note of the tone of voice they use as well as the overall appearance of their profiles. Determine their advantages and disadvantages. What are they doing particularly well on social media, and where can you capitalize to differentiate yourself? Examine the level of engagement with their posts. Is their audience actively engaging with their content? Understanding their level of engagement will assist you in setting reasonable goals for your own social media performance. Take cues from successful strategies, but avoid directly replicating them. Your social media presence should be consistent with your distinct brand identity and value proposition. Choosing the Right Platform Advertisements on Google and Bing When it comes to pay-per-click (PPC) advertising, the market is primarily controlled by two platforms: Google Ads and Bing Ads. Because it is the most popular platform, Google Ads provides users with extensive targeting options as well as a wide reach. Bing Ads, on the other hand, not only gives users access to a different audience but also has the potential to be more cost-effective. As a marketing agency, we strongly suggest making use of both platforms if you want your campaign to have the greatest possible reach and impact. Management of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Campaigns Done Right In order to successfully manage a pay-per-click (PPC) campaign, careful planning and ongoing optimization are required. The following are some of the most important considerations to make: Careful planning Bidding on Keywords Before you begin bidding on keywords, you should conduct extensive keyword research to determine which keywords are the most relevant to your industry and also perform the best. Determine your strategy for bidding on the basis of factors such as the competitiveness of the market, the volume of searches, and your budget. Ad Targeting Determine who you want to see your advertisements by analyzing their demographics, interests, and location. Utilize the various targeting options at your disposal to hone in on your target demographic and connect with the leads most likely to result in a sale. Ad Copywriting Create ads that are compelling and engaging while highlighting your unique selling propositions (USPs). Place an emphasis on the benefits, include an effective call to action, and check that the ad copy and the landing page are consistent with one another. Landing Page Optimization In order to optimize your landing pages, you should first create dedicated landing pages that are in line with your ad copy and offer a consistent and enjoyable user experience . If you want to maximize conversions. you should optimize your landing pages so that they load more quickly, have clear messaging, and have an intuitive design. Leveraging Remarketing Utilizing Remarketing in Order to Achieve Greater Conversions Remarketing is a powerful strategy. That enables you to target users who have interacted with your website or advertisements in the past. It gives you the ability to do this. You can improve users’ ability to recall your brand and encourage them to return to your site by displaying ads that are specifically tailored to the users in question. Improving your overall conversion rates can be accomplished by running remarketing campaigns on online advertising platforms such as Google Ads and Bing Ads. Conversion Tracking and PPC Analytics Tracking Tracking of Conversions and Analyzing Pay-Per-Click Ads The success of your pay-per-click (PPC) advertising campaigns . Can only be accurately measured by tracking conversions. Conversion tracking allows you to keep tabs on the activities that users perform on your website. such as filling out forms, making purchases, or signing up for newsletters. Conduct an analysis of the data that is provided by the PPC analytics tools offered by the platforms in order to gain insights into the performance of your campaign. locate areas that could be improved, and make decisions that are driven by the data in order to maximize your return on investment.
